Smart Lighting Solutions for Enhanced Focus

As we adapt to remote work, improving our home office environment becomes crucial for maintaining productivity. One effective way to achieve this is through smart lighting. By utilizing adjustable brightness and color temperatures, I can create lighting scenes tailored for specific tasks, enhancing my focus. These settings allow me to seamlessly shift between work modes without distractions.

Moreover, smart lighting mimics natural daylight, which helps regulate my circadian rhythm, promoting better sleep quality and, in turn, improving my focus during work hours. With automated schedules, I eliminate manual adjustments, ensuring my workspace is always ideally lit. This combination of focus enhancement and adaptability makes smart lighting a critical component of my home office setup. Additionally, energy-efficient bulbs can save up to 80% on electricity bills, making them a cost-effective choice for long-term use.

Smart Networking and Connectivity for Reliable Performance

smart home office networking

Reliable performance in a home office hinges on effective networking and connectivity solutions. To guarantee a seamless experience, adopting advanced technology like Wi-Fi 6 or 6E is essential. These systems reduce congestion and boost speed, especially for video calls and file transfers. Utilizing dual-band or tri-band routers creates dedicated channels for IoT devices, minimizing interference with critical applications.

Moreover, bandwidth optimization tools help prioritize essential activities, making sure your work remains uninterrupted. Implementing network segmentation further enhances security by separating guest and business networks, safeguarding sensitive data. Automatic failover systems can provide backup connections, assuring uninterrupted access. With these smart networking strategies, your home office can achieve reliable performance, making remote work more efficient and productive.

What Are the Security Risks Associated With Iot Devices in Home Offices?

IoT devices can pose serious security risks, especially regarding data privacy. I’ve found that device vulnerabilities, like default passwords and outdated software, make my home office a target for cyber attacks, increasing my exposure to threats.
